Most buyers are surprised this 6kg desktop unit hits 2490*G at 4500rpm — that RCF is better than many larger centrifuges for PRF, PRP, and general sample separation, and the 70W brushless DC motor keeps noise down and runtime consistent.
Speed range runs 300 to 4500rpm, and you can set run time form 30 seconds up to 99 minutes — we've had labs use it for quick spin-downs and longer serum separations in the same shift, and the alloy construction handles the load without flex.
It fits 8×15mL or 12×10mL/7mL/5mL vacuum tubes, so it's basically a workhorse for small-batch clinical or industrial testing — just don't expect it to handle 50mL tubes or high-throughput processing.
